West Virginia Rent Ranges
On average, rent in the state of West Virginia falls anywhere from < $700/mo on the low end to > $2,000/mo at the max. Most rental prices fall within the $700 - $1,000/mo range.
West Virginia Average Rent
The average rent for a one-bedroom apartment in West Virginia is around $965. Use the chart below to compare West Virginia’s average rent prices over time.
